Two arrested in Bellingham related to regional drug bust

BELLINGHAM, WA (MyBellinghamNow.com) – Two Bellingham men have been arrested in connection to a narcotics investigation.

The Whatcom County Sheriff’s Office says that their Regional Drug Task Force identified the suspects as drug runners for a supplier in Federal Way.

Investigators were granted a search warrant for a Federal Way home earlier this month, where they seized over 30 pounds of fentanyl-laced pills.

22-year-old Alfio Felix Rivera was arrested and booked into the Whatcom County Jail.

The Regional Drug Task Force served additional search warrants on two Bellingham properties on Tuesday.

That warrant led to the arrest of 26-year-old Omar Gaona Garcia and 23-year-old Jorge Ramos.

Investigators believe the suspects’ activities are tied to a criminal organization based out of Mexico.
